What are the responsibilities and job description for the EMT position at National Medic?
Responsibilities:
- Respond to emergent and non-emergent calls and provide medical assistance to patients in various settings, including homes, public places, and the ER.
- Assess patients' conditions and administer appropriate medical treatments and interventions.
- Safely transport patients to medical facilities while providing continuous care and monitoring.
- Communicate with healthcare professionals, such as doctors and nurses, to provide accurate patient information and receive instructions.
- Document all patient interactions, treatments, and observations accurately and in a timely manner.
- Maintain and clean medical equipment and supplies.
Requirements:
- Valid certification as an Emergency Medical Technician (EMT).
- Knowledge of emergency medical procedures, protocols, and techniques.
- Ability to drive an ambulance safely and responsibly.
- Physical fitness to perform heavy lifting and maneuvering of patients in emergency situations.
- Excellent communication skills to effectively interact with patients, families, and healthcare professionals.
- Ability to remain calm under pressure and make quick decisions in critical situations.
- Willingness to work irregular h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
